Что такое бинарная система?

Бинарная система – это способ представления информации, который основывается на использовании только двух цифр: 0 и 1. Данный способ широко используется в компьютерах и другой электронной технике. В данной системе каждая цифра представляет собой один из двух возможных состояний, например: включено-выключено, находится-отсутствует и т.д.

Бинарная система основывается на двоичной арифметике, которая отличается от десятичной тем, что каждое разрядное число в целочисленных числах домножается на 2 в степени -n, где n – номер разряда. Например, в двоичной системе число 1010 будет эквивалентно числу 10 в десятичной системе.

Для выполнения действий над числами в бинарной системе используются особые правила, которые похожи на правила в десятичной системе. Например, для сложения чисел в бинарной системе нужно пройти по каждому разряду и выполнить сложение цифр. Если в результате сложения на каком-то разряде получается число, большее или равное двум, то в этом разряде записывается остаток от деления на два, а единица переносится на следующий разряд.

Бинарная система: что это такое и как она работает

Бинарная система — это система счисления, в которой используются только два символа: 0 и 1. Она широко применяется в электронике и информатике для хранения и передачи информации.

В бинарной системе числа записываются с помощью разрядов, каждый из которых может принимать только два значения: 0 или 1. При этом каждый разряд имеет свой вес, который определяет его значение в числе. Например, в двоичном числе 1011 первый разряд имеет вес 8, второй — 4, третий — 2, а четвертый — 1.

Бинарная система используется в микропроцессорах и компьютерах для представления и обработки информации. Каждый символ, буква или число, внутри компьютера представлен в виде набора нулей и единиц, которые могут быть обработаны и переданы далее.

С помощью бинарной системы происходит передача и обработка данных внутри компьютера и в сети. Например, при отправке электронного письма или загрузке файла из интернета данные передаются в виде набора битов (нулей и единиц), которые в конечном итоге интерпретируются как текст, звук, видео и т.д.

Бинарная система счисления — это основа для работы с цифровой информацией, и без нее не было бы современной электроники и информационных технологий.

Определение бинарной системы

Бинарная система — это система с двумя компонентами, которые вращаются вокруг своего общего центра массы. Такие системы можно найти во всем Вселенной — включая двойные звезды, двойные планеты, двойные астероиды и т.д.

Одна из особенностей бинарных систем — это то, что они образуются из-за силы притяжения между двумя объектами. Если два объекта находятся достаточно близко друг к другу, то их силы притяжения могут стать достаточно сильными, чтобы держать их вместе.

Бинарные системы предоставляют ученым уникальную возможность изучения различных физических процессов, таких как эволюция звезд, динамика планетных систем и сильные гравитационные поля. Применение технологий наблюдения позволяет нам получать более глубокие понимания этих процессов, что в свою очередь может помочь в дальнейшем развитии нашего понимания о природе Вселенной.

История создания бинарной системы

Бинарная система была создана вследствие необходимости представления чисел в электронных устройствах. Еще в 19 веке Булл и Бёрнетт в своих трудах изучали свойства булевых функций. Однако широкое использование binarnyh кодов началось в середине 20 века.

В 1930 году американский математик Клауд Шеннон в своей докторской диссертации продемонстрировал, что любая логическая функция может быть представлена как комбинация базовых логических функций, а именно: НЕ, И, ИЛИ. Таким образом, он достиг важного открытия — возможность использования двоичной системы числения в электронных устройствах.

Он показал, что двоичная система численных кодов может быть использована для представления в любой системе переменных, как логических функций так и чисел. В электронике это означает, что с помощью двоичных кодов можно представлять информацию с минимальным количеством логических элементов, что позволяет производить вычисления очень быстро.

Система двоичного кодирования стала широко применяться в электронике, в особенности, в создании компьютеров. Сегодня эта система используется повсеместно, и невозможно представить современный мир без бинарных преобразований.

Представление чисел в бинарной системе

Бинарная система — это система счисления, в которой используется два символа: 0 и 1. В компьютерном мире бинарная система используется для представления данных и информации, так как компьютеры работают с двоичными числами.

Представление чисел в бинарной системе осуществляется путем разбиения десятичного числа на разряды, где каждый разряд может принимать значение либо 0, либо 1.

Например, число 69 в двоичной системе будет представляться следующим образом: 1000101.

Для перевода десятичного числа в двоичную систему необходимо использовать так называемое «деление на 2». Этот алгоритм заключается в последовательном делении десятичного числа на 2, при этом остаток каждого деления записывается в обратном порядке.

Кроме того, в бинарной системе можно выполнять арифметические операции такие как сложение, вычитание, умножение и деление. Например, для сложения двух двоичных чисел необходимо сложить соответствующие разряды и если результатом является двойка, то в следующий разряд необходимо добавить единицу.

Таким образом, бинарная система позволяет представлять числа двумя символами, что значительно упрощает работу с компьютерами и другими цифровыми устройствами.

Преобразование чисел из бинарной системы в десятичную и обратно

Бинарная система счисления играет важную роль в программировании, где информация обрабатывается только в виде нулей и единиц, а также может быть полезна при передаче данных через сеть. Однако, в повседневной жизни мы имеем дело с десятичной системой счисления, что означает, что необходимы инструменты для преобразования чисел.

Для преобразования чисел из бинарной системы в десятичную необходимо каждой цифре двоичного числа присвоить вес, начиная с первого разряда справа и умножить его на соответствующее значение степени двойки. Значения результата умножения всех цифр суммируются, что дает десятичное значение.

Пример:

  • 1010 в двоичной системе = 1 * 2^3 + 0 * 2^2 + 1 * 2^1 + 0 * 2^0 = 8 + 0 + 2 + 0 = 10 в десятичной системе;
  • 10011 в двоичной системе = 1 * 2^4 + 0 * 2^3 + 0 * 2^2 + 1 * 2^1 + 1 * 2^0 = 16 + 0 + 0 + 2 + 1 = 19 в десятичной системе.

Для преобразования чисел из десятичной системы в бинарную необходимо последовательно делить число на два до тех пор, пока не получим ноль. Остатки от деления записываются в обратном порядке. Таким образом, результатом будет двоичное число.

Пример:

  • 15 в десятичной системе = 1111 в двоичной системе (15 / 2 = 7 ост. 1; 7 / 2 = 3 ост. 1; 3 / 2 = 1 ост. 1; 1 / 2 = 0 ост. 1)
  • 27 в десятичной системе = 11011 в двоичной системе (27 / 2 = 13 ост. 1; 13 / 2 = 6 ост. 1; 6 / 2 = 3 ост. 0; 3 / 2 = 1 ост. 1; 1 / 2 = 0 ост. 1)

Применение бинарной системы в компьютерной технике

Бинарная система, основанная на двоичном коде, используется в компьютерной технике для представления и обработки данных. В компьютерах данные хранятся в виде двоичных цифр — 0 и 1. Эта система дает возможность эффективно обрабатывать и хранить большие объемы информации.

Одна из ключевых задач, для которых используется бинарная система, является выполнение арифметических операций, таких как сложение, вычитание, умножение и деление. Компьютеры используют бинарную систему для выполнения этих операций, используя электронические элементы для представления и обработки двоичных цифр.

В бинарной системе используются логические операторы, такие как И, ИЛИ и НЕ, которые позволяют обрабатывать данные более эффективно. Кроме того, бинарная система также используется для представления графических изображений и звуковых файлов, которые хранятся в виде двоичных данных.

Для упрощения работы с бинарной системой, программисты используют различные алгоритмы и программное обеспечение, которые позволяют работать с данными в более удобной форме. Одним из самых популярных языков программирования является язык С, который широко используется для разработки приложений и системного программного обеспечения.

Таким образом, бинарная система играет важную роль в компьютерной технике и является одной из основных технологий, которые позволяют обрабатывать и хранить информацию в современных компьютерах.

Особенности работы алгоритмов на основе бинарных чисел

Бинарные числа используются в алгоритмах, которые основаны на принципах логики и вычислений с двумя значениями: 1 и 0. Одно из преимуществ использования бинарных чисел в алгоритмах заключается в том, что они ускоряют вычисления и экономят затраты памяти.

Алгоритмы на основе бинарных чисел широко применяются в различных областях: от современной криптографии до программирования электроники. С помощью бинарных чисел можно производить операции логического умножения, сложения и других операций.

При использовании бинарных чисел в алгоритмах важно учитывать их специфику. Например, битовые операции могут привести к потере точности, если количество бит в числе не соответствует требованиям алгоритма. Кроме того, при работе с большими числами на основе бинарной системы необходимо учитывать особенности их представления и вычислений, чтобы избежать ошибок.

Некоторые алгоритмы могут работать только с целыми числами на основе двоичной системы. Если используются дробные числа, то при вычислениях могут возникнуть проблемы с точностью. Поэтому необходимо тщательно выбирать типы данных при работе с бинарными числами в алгоритмах.

В целом, использование бинарных чисел в алгоритмах обеспечивает эффективность работы программных систем, которые используют логические операции и вычисления с двумя значениями. При правильном использовании бинарные числа могут значительно облегчить процесс вычислений и ускорить работу системы.

Преимущества и недостатки использования бинарной системы

Бинарная система – это основа работы компьютеров. Она удобна для хранения и обработки информации, так как все данные представлены двоичными цифрами – 0 и 1. Однако, использование бинарной системы имеет свои преимущества и недостатки.

  • Преимущества:
    • Эффективность – бинарная система требует минимального количества элементов для представления информации, что позволяет сократить ее объем и увеличить скорость обработки.
    • Надежность – двоичные коды позволяют корректно выполнять математические операции с данными и исключают возможность ошибок из-за неправильной интерпретации кода.
    • Универсальность – бинарная система применяется в технологических процессах, начиная от проектирования логических схем и заканчивая обработкой изображений и видео.
  • Недостатки:
    • Сложность понимания – из-за отсутствия привычных символов нуля и единицы приходится использовать дополнительные обозначения, что может затруднять восприятие информации.
    • Невозможность точной дробной записи – бинарная система может представить только целые числа, в связи с этим возникают проблемы при работе с дробными значениями, что требует дополнительных вычислительных операций.
    • Ограниченный диапазон значений – бинарная система имеет ограниченный диапазон значений, что ограничивает точность работы и не позволяет представлять большие числа.

Вопрос-ответ

Оцените статью
OttoHome